Many times, the contents of files get broken up at different locations in the hard disk. With the help of disk derangement, it is possible to bring all the fragments at one location and raise efficiency of working

Computer Basic Input/Output System (BIOS), operating systems and utility software are the three important types of system software. Some more system software types which are readily used these days are Loaders, Shells, database management systems such as SQL and Linkers. The system software which is stored on non volatile memory is known as firmware.